LUND v. SCHRADER

No. 3995.

492 P.2d 202 (1971)

Anita M. LUND et al., Appellants (Plaintiffs below), v. Robert G. SCHRADER, State Superintendent of Public Instruction, et al., Appellees (Defendants below).

Supreme Court of Wyoming.

December 29, 1971.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Robert R. Rose, Jr., Casper, for appellants.

Donald L. Painter, Asst. Atty. Gen., Cheyenne, for appellees.

Before McINTYRE, C.J., and PARKER, McEWAN, and GRAY, JJ.


Chief Justice McINTYRE delivered the opinion of the court.

Pursuant to the Wyoming School District Organization Law of 1969, §§ 21.1-105 to 21.1-135, W.S. 1957, 1971 Cum.Supp., the county committee of Johnson County submitted a plan for the unification of the entire county into a single school district. The plan was approved by the state committee and trustees were elected for the unified district.
